Display not working - White screen
Hello, I soldered and attached the Adafruit 2.8" PiTFT - Capacitive Touch to my Ra pi. Followed the easy installation and booted. I only get white screen display. However i when i run the touch test event i'm able to see the touch. Find the attached solder picture and dmesg. Let me know if there is any other way to test and fix this or RMA it?

Re: Display not working - White screen
Those look like cold-solder joints. You'll have to reheat them, Make sure to touch the iron to both the pad and the pin. A good solder joint should be smooth and shiny with a concave section, like this:
The solder should flow completely over the pad and up the pin. You can see the pad on several of your solder joints - that shouldn't be the case.
